Eupafolin in Nature and Science: Occurrence, Chemistry, Biosynthesis, Analytical Methods, and Potential Multifaceted
Olusesan Ojo1, Gerhard Prinsloo1
1Department of Agriculture and Animal Health, University of South Africa, Johannesburg, South Africa.
Eupafolin, a bioactive flavonoid, exhibits diverse pharmacological effects like anti-inflammatory and anticancer properties. Further research is needed to establish its safety profile for drug development and agricultural applications.
Area of Science:
- Pharmacology
- Pharmaceutical Nanotechnology
- Agriculture
Background:
- Eupafolin (nepetin) is a bioactive flavonoid with a flavone backbone and hydroxyl groups.
- It is found in various medicinal plants and possesses significant biological activities.
Purpose of the Study:
- To review eupafolin's natural occurrence, chemical structure, and biosynthetic pathway.
- To highlight its roles in pharmacology, pharmaceutical nanotechnology, and agriculture.
- To emphasize its potential in drug development, nanomedicine, and plant protection.
Main Methods:
- Literature review sourcing data from Google Scholar, Science Direct, Scopus, and PubMed up to April 2025.
- Analysis of over 100 electronic references.
Main Results:
- Eupafolin demonstrates anti-inflammatory, anticancer, antioxidant, antidiabetic, antimicrobial, and neuroprotective effects.
- It shows promise in drug development and green nanoparticle synthesis for nanomedicine.
- Potential applications in plant protection and stress tolerance enhancement were identified.
Conclusions:
- Eupafolin has broad potential in medicine, pharmaceutical nanotechnology, and agriculture.
- Further in vitro and in vivo studies are crucial to determine its safety profile for drug development.
- Robust research is needed to fully explore its therapeutic and agricultural applications.
